SOLDIER MEMBERS

AGREEMENT BETWEEN PARTIES [Psr Ukitid Peess Association.! WELLINGTON, February 22, ’ An understanding has been entered into by Mr Fraser and Mr Holland to do everything in their power to get their supporters to vote solidly at tha next general election for members of Parliament on active service who seek re-election. This is to be done regardless of the party to which tha absent soldier-member belongs. An arrangement has been made to deal with the situation that will arise in the event of a person claiming to be an independent candidate or the candidate of some party other than tha Labour Party or the National Party contesting the seats hold by members serving with the Armed Forces,
